Well-heeled guests choose from luxury villas or suites; most of them have gorgeous private pools and sweeping views of the Andaman Sea. It would be easy to spend an entire vacation holed up in the villas, which get stocked with guests' favorite foods, and a private chef comes to prepare customized meals.

"On a secluded island reached by a 40-minute powerboat cruise past the limestone outcrops of Phang Nga Bay, these pool villas all have private butlers, and most have panoramic views of the sea."
i
When to go: Seas and skies are calm December through March.
